What is the ACH Schwab MoneyLink Form?
The ACH Schwab MoneyLink Form is an essential document used for establishing, modifying, or terminating electronic fund transfers between a Charles Schwab account and other U.S. financial institutions. This form is crucial for Schwab account holders and provides functionalities that allow users to manage their finances effectively.
This electronic fund transfer form plays a vital role in enabling one-time and recurring transfers. By using the form, users can easily authorize investment advisors and manage income distributions, ensuring a streamlined financial process.

Who is eligible to use the ACH Schwab MoneyLink Form?
Individuals and businesses that hold an account with Charles Schwab or another U.S. financial institution can use this form to set up electronic fund transfers.
What information do I need to complete the form?
Before filling out the form, gather your Schwab account number, the name associated with the other financial institution account, and the ABA Transit Routing Number to ensure a smooth process.
Is notarization required for this form?
Notarization is generally not required for the ACH Schwab MoneyLink Form, but ensure that all Schwab account holders sign where indicated to avoid processing delays.
How do I submit the completed form?
After completing the form on pdfFiller, you can submit it digitally through the platform, or download it and mail it directly to the financial institution as needed.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out the form?
Common mistakes include missing required signatures, incorrect account numbers, and failing to provide accurate routing information, which can delay processing.
How long does it take to process the form?
Processing times can vary, but typically it takes 3-5 business days for transfers to be established once the form is submitted.
What should I do if I need to make changes after submitting the form?
If changes are needed after submission, contact your financial institution directly to inquire about their process for modifications to authorized transfers.
